Setting off from Queenstown, the meeting point is straightforward — look for the blue “Catch a Fish” boat with the logo flag at the jetty. The trip lasts exactly three hours, a duration that offers a good balance: enough time to relax and fish without feeling rushed.
Once aboard, the first thing you notice is the quiet hum of the electric trolling motor. Unlike traditional gas-powered boats, this motor keeps noise levels down—meaning less disturbance to the fish and a more peaceful experience overall. It also helps you appreciate the pristine environment that surrounds you, from the towering peaks to the shimmering waters.
Your guide, with over a decade of experience, takes a personable approach—explaining the techniques of using advanced downriggers to target trout and salmon. We loved the way the guide’s knowledge makes even novices feel confident, while the seasoned anglers can refine their tactics. The gear provided is top-quality, making a real difference in how smoothly and effectively you fish.
The scenery during the trip is truly remarkable. As you cast your line, you will enjoy stunning views of Cecil Peak, Walter Peak, and The Remarkables, which frame the lake beautifully. It’s a scene that feels almost cinematic—a perfect backdrop for a fishing adventure.
Catching fish in Lake Wakatipu can be rewarding. Many reviews mention a high “strike rate,” meaning bites are frequent enough to keep everyone engaged. One guest even noted that their “great strike rate on all bites” kept the excitement high. When you do land a fish—be it a trout or salmon—you have the option to keep it, as long as it’s within local limits. The boat crew will clean and vacuum-pack your catch, making it easy to transport home or enjoy fresh.
Snacks and non-alcoholic beverages are included, so you can stay refreshed without needing to bring your own supplies. The relaxed, small-group setting—limited to six participants—ensures personalized attention and a less hurried atmosphere.

Do I need a fishing license for this trip?
Yes, you must have an NZ fishing license to participate. You can purchase one online or on the boat.
Is this experience suitable for children?
Yes, it’s suitable for all ages. Children under 12 need to be booked with at least one adult.
How long is the trip?
The adventure lasts exactly 3 hours, making it a manageable outing.
What’s included in the price?
You get an expert-guided fishing trip, top-quality gear, snacks and non-alcoholic beverages, and the option to keep and vacuum-pack your catch.
Can I keep my fish?
Yes, within local limits, you can keep your catch, and the crew will clean and vacuum-pack it for you.
What if the trip doesn’t reach minimum bookings?
You’ll be contacted 24 hours in advance if there are not enough bookings, and your reservation may be canceled or rescheduled.
Is transportation to the jetty included?
No, you’ll need to arrange your own transportation to the meeting point at the jetty.
Can I book a private trip?
Yes, by booking for 6 people, you can secure the whole boat for a private experience with just your group and the skipper.
